Essay

This dissertation focuses on the study of rhythmic organization of English political discourse conditioned by the integration of prosodic and semantic rhythms the interaction of which establishes general balance of structural dynamics. It has been found that the specific character of rhythmic organization of English political discourse is predetermined by its communicative pragmatic dominant, genre peculiarities, and the interaction of two anthropocentres creating an adequate rhetoric strategy of English political discourse. Based on the English political speeches of contemporary British politicians peculiar features of communicative timbre of English political discourse have been determined. The communicative timbre, being a synthesis of interaction and variation of the most important components of the language prosodic level, has a certain rhythmometric dimension, which corresponds to the level of expressiveness and ascertains the logic-and-sense delimitation specificity. Invariant and variant prosodic features of the rhythmic model of English political discourse manifested in their melodic, dynamic and temporal characteristics have been experimentally determined. The correlation of prosodic markers and rhythmic units (i.e. syntagms, phrases, intraphrasal and superphrasal units) in the informational space of the discourse creates a macrostep, which is a unit of a certain hierarchical organization, predetermining political speech genre originality.
